Chapter 206: The Tug-of-War (Part 2)

"Truly, fortune turns like a wheel; today it comes to my door."

Watching County Mayor Ma Youcai of Yiyang lead a group of government officials into the conference room, Zhang Mushan kept his face impassive, though his heart was far from calm. He couldn't help but let out a silent sigh.

Back in the days of the dual-track pricing system, he had once stood outside the home of a section chief in Lingxi until two in the morning, just to secure a quota slip for fertilizer. That section chief had returned home drunk and ignored him completely.

Now, Qingda Group and Zhang Mushan were honored guests across Lingxi. In a sense, local governments, eager to attract investment, had granted them privileges that stretched beyond the law. Rumors circulated everywhere—of police standing guard to protect businessmen engaging in illicit activities, and other such irregularities.

The father of reform had once said with witty precision, "It doesn't matter if a cat is black or white, as long as it catches mice." This simple truth had withstood the test of reform and opening-up. Under the baton of GDP growth, local governments competed fiercely. "It doesn't matter if a cat is black or white, as long as it attracts investment"—this had become the consensus among officials. The nature of the enterprise no longer mattered; anyone who invested was considered an outstanding entrepreneur.

To the left of Mayor Ma sat Vice County Mayor Gao; to his right was Yang Dajin, Director of the Development Planning Commission. Sitting on either side were Su Ming, Party Secretary of Qinglin Town, and Liu Kun, Acting Town Mayor. Directly opposite the officials sat Zhang Mushan, CEO of Qingda Company, along with his deputies.

Hou Weidong’s participation in the negotiations had been accidental. He and Li Jing were accompanying Zhang Mushan for breakfast when Liu Tao from the County Committee Office and Yang Dajin from the Development Planning Commission arrived at the hotel. Liu Tao had come to deliver small gifts from the County Committee Office to Zhang Mushan, while Yang Dajin had come specifically to invite Zhang to the morning negotiation session.

Hou Weidong had simply tagged along.

Hou Weidong sat next to Liu Kun. As they took their seats, Hou Weidong initiated the conversation. "Town Mayor Liu, congratulations." Liu Kun had not long held the top position, but his demeanor and speech already carried the weight of a leader. He replied politely, "Director Hou has moved to a leadership role in the county. I hope you will continue to care for us township cadres in the future."

Due to the election incident, Hou Weidong and Liu Kun had never gotten along. Initially, they refused to speak to each other. Later, they maintained a superficial harmony while harboring mutual resentment. Now that both had new opportunities for advancement, they began to mask their earlier unpleasantness.

The meeting began with Mayor Ma delivering a welcome speech.

"Respected Mr. Zhang and friends from Qingda Company, on behalf of the Yiyang County People's Government and the seven hundred thousand residents of Yiyang, I extend a warm welcome to Mr. Zhang and his delegation for their visit to Yiyang.

Yiyang is an ancient city. A millennium of historical and cultural accumulation has endowed the people of Yiyang with excellent qualities of diligence, pragmatism, innovation, and adaptability. These are the fundamental conditions for Yiyang's inevitable rise. Yiyang is also a developing city. Compared to cities in the east and prefecture-level cities in Lingxi, we have a significant gap. This gap signifies backwardness, but it also signifies potential for development.

Yiyang is rich in natural resources, including coal, copper, and limestone. It is a treasure trove waiting to be developed. On behalf of the government, I sincerely hope to cooperate with Qingda Group. I am confident that both sides will achieve a win-win outcome."

After Mayor Ma finished his welcome speech, Vice County Mayor Gao, who was in charge of industry, introduced Yiyang County's policies for attracting investment. This was followed by Su Ming, Party Secretary of Qinglin Town, who introduced the mineral resources of Shangqinglin.

Zhang Mushan was already well aware of the information provided by Vice County Mayor Gao and Su Ming. Qingda Group's plan to invest and build a factory in Shangqinglin was clear, but he was in no hurry to commit. Negotiation was a technical skill; dragging things out at this stage would secure greater benefits for the company.

Huang Yishu, Vice President of Qingda Company, was just over thirty. He was a rare returnee from overseas among Lingxi enterprises. Zhang Mushan intended to make him the general manager of the company and had entrusted him with many important tasks. At this moment, Huang Yishu held a large, old-fashioned fountain pen with a bulbous barrel, rapidly jotting down data in his notebook.

On another page of his notebook, he had written a few key points: "Land requisition and demolition resettlement, hardening of the Shangqinglin road, three-year tax refunds, and loans." These were the issues that needed to be resolved during the negotiations.

When the Yiyang side finished their presentation, Zhang Mushan took off his glasses and placed them casually on the table. "Qingda Group is one of the top fifty enterprises in Lingxi and the only private enterprise to make the list. Last year, the group's total assets reached two billion yuan. Our main businesses are construction, transportation, and related industries. We are honored to have been invited to Yiyang. Through three days of inspection and study, we have gained a deeper understanding of Yiyang. Now, I would like to invite Mr. Huang Yishu, Vice President of the group, to represent the group in discussing specific issues with the Yiyang government."

Huang Yishu spoke with an American accent. "Qingda Group has a project for a cement plant with a capacity of five hundred thousand tons. Our company has conducted inspections in various places in Lingxi, and Shangqinglin is one of the alternative sites. There is a flat area at the foot of Tiejian Mountain in Shangqinglin, with open terrain and a pond of about five mu, which is quite suitable for building a factory."

A hint of joy appeared on Vice County Mayor Gao's face. He turned to Su Ming and asked, "Tiejian Mountain in Shangqinglin, do you know it?"

Neither Su Ming nor Liu Kun was familiar with this remote place name. They both looked toward Hou Weidong. Mayor Ma Youcai, realizing that the top leaders of Qinglin Town's Party and government did not know the location, frowned slightly.

Hou Weidong exchanged a glance with Su Ming and said, "Tiejian Mountain is located between Dushi Village and Jianshan Village. It is a relatively flat plateau of about three hundred mu, shared equally by the two villages, with about thirty households living there."

Huang Yishu nodded. "That is the land we are referring to. There are nineteen households in Dushi Village and seventeen in Jianshan Village."

Mayor Ma Youcai's expression softened somewhat.

A few drops of cold sweat appeared on Su Ming's forehead. He thought to himself, "Fortunately, Hou Weidong is here, otherwise we would have lost face greatly." Looking at Liu Kun, whose hair was slightly curly, he felt a sense of complaint. "Liu Kun is fine as a deputy secretary, but he lacks the ability to be the top leader. If Hou Weidong were the acting town mayor, my life would be much easier."

The negotiations then entered a phase of mutual probing. Issues such as land requisition and three-year tax refunds were discussed in detail. Yang Dajin, a veteran director of the Development Planning Commission, and Vice County Mayor Gao became the main negotiators. However, there was a significant gap between the two sides' demands. The entire morning passed without reaching a consensus on any of the issues.

Although Hou Weidong attended the meeting, he was essentially an outsider, merely listening to the two sides haggle.

In the blink of an eye, it was 11:40 AM. Mayor Ma Youcai, deeply understanding the principle that "bargaining is for the buyer," felt that since Qingda Group was not yielding an inch, there was still room for deal-making. Taking advantage of a pause in the argument, he smiled and said, "It's getting late. Work is important, but so is everyone's health. Let's stop here for this morning. Qinglin Town will host lunch."

He joked, "Secretary Su, Qingda Group is a large company from the provincial capital. You must bring out some good stuff to entertain them."

For this lunch, Yang Dajin had already given instructions to Su Ming. Su Ming was well-prepared. "Qinglin may not have much else, but we have plenty of wild game. Shangqinglin is famous for its cured mountain chickens, a folk craft passed down for hundreds of years. Today, we invite Mr. Zhang, Mr. Huang, and other distinguished guests to taste this local delicacy."

Zhang Mushan chuckled. "The wild game of Shangqinglin is truly mouth-watering. Even if the cement plant doesn't settle in Shangqinglin, I'm considering investing in a hunting club."

Mayor Ma Youcai said, "A gentleman's word…"

Zhang Mushan replied, "…is harder to chase than four horses."

The atmosphere between hosts and guests was harmonious. Two bottles of Changyu red wine were opened to liven up the mood.

At the banquet, the Yiyang County Government delegation was led by Mayor Ma Youcai, with Su Ming and Liu Kun from Qinglin Town present. Hou Weidong sat at a table with staff from the Development Planning Commission and the County Government Office, naturally becoming a supporting character. Fortunately, the Shangqinglin cured mountain chicken was indeed delicious. He buried his head in the bones, savoring the lingering fragrance.

After lunch, it was only one o'clock. Zhang Mushan and his team returned to the hotel. Su Ming and Liu Kun were called by Yang Dajin to the Development Planning Commission to discuss strategies. Hou Weidong returned to the Organization Department.

The afternoon session was scheduled for two o'clock. Hou Weidong stood at the office door, hesitating for a moment. Although Secretary Zhu Yan had asked him to accompany Zhang Mushan throughout, the host of the meeting, Yang Dajin of the Development Planning Commission, had not invited him to the afternoon negotiations during the lunch gathering.

"Secretary Zhu Yan only asked me to accompany Zhang Mushan. I've accompanied him for three days, so I've fulfilled my task." After a brief internal struggle, Hou Weidong decided not to attend the afternoon negotiations.

Just past two o'clock, Guo Lan pushed the door open punctually. Seeing Hou Weidong sitting at his desk reading a newspaper, she said, "Oh? You're back at work?"

Hou Weidong smiled. "If I don't come back to work for a few days, and the Organization Department decides they don't want me anymore, that would be terrible."

Guo Lan was elegant, carrying the grace and poise nurtured by her scholarly family background. Hearing Hou Weidong's joke, she smiled faintly and said, "You're back at just the right time. The county is preparing to hold a major conference on the construction of the scientific and technological talent team. Our section is in charge of the preparations. Old詹 (Zhan) has taken sick leave, and I was worried about being overwhelmed."

She retrieved a file from the cabinet and said, "This is the file from last year's scientific and technological talent team construction. Take a look first. I'll start writing the meeting plan."

A widely circulated office saying goes, "Men and women working together make the work less tiring." Guo Lan's temperament was like the fragrance of jasmine, calming the nerves. Hou Weidong quietly read through the file, and the two exchanged occasional comments. Time flew by according to the laws of relativity, and soon it was time to get off work.

Hou Weidong put the file away and said, "It's time to get off work. I'll head out first." Guo Lan, to avoid suspicion, generally did not ride in Hou Weidong's car. Hou Weidong was well aware of this, so even though they were heading in the same direction, he did not invite Guo Lan to ride with him.

As he stepped out the door, he saw Liu Tao from the County Committee Office walking over.

"Didn't you attend the symposium with Qingda this afternoon?"

"I didn't attend," Hou Weidong added. "The negotiations were hosted by the Development Planning Commission. They didn't notify me to join the afternoon session."

Liu Tao said, "Zhang Mushan and his team have returned to Lingxi. Secretary Zhu and Mayor Ma are very angry. You need to go after them."
